Transaction 891efbfbffecad744f1b3da63f326a2d85a4e87e7ce8231873e8831cac3bd940

1 Input
2 Outputs
  • 891efbfbffecad744f1b3da63f326a2d85a4e87e7ce8231873e8831cac3bd940:0
  • value  1225000
    address  13xnGHCDnDn8yMwvx61d3MNWSUeid7GE8Y
  • 891efbfbffecad744f1b3da63f326a2d85a4e87e7ce8231873e8831cac3bd940:1
  • value  518398210
    address  1AHfCDGCNvJM6crKFSF67mnu7bBMiziwKc